If President-elect Donald Trump chooses retired four-star Gen. David Petraeus as secretary of state, the former military commander would have 72 hours to give his probation officer a heads-up about the new gig.
The notification is just one of the legal strings binding Petraeus as part of his April 23, 2015, probation for giving his mistress classified information, USA Today's Brad Heath reported Wednesday, tweeting out the court document describing the restrictions.
